Doesn't look like this has been asked in this thread yet -- how is the "Fan Level" determined? And can users change it? I don't see an option in my profile settings...

Thanks!

:)

Link to comment
Share on other sites

@pre

Here are the post count requirements for fan levels:

Fan Level: n00b --- 0 posts

Fan Level: Casual --- 50 posts

Fan Level: Hooked --- 100 posts

Fan Level: Addicted --- 500 posts

Fan Level: Fanatic --- 1,000 posts

Fan Level: Hardcore --- 5,000 posts

Fan Level: Obsessed --- 10,000 posts

Fan Level: Rainbow --- 30,000 posts

At this time, customizing your fan level is not an option. Sorry. ^^;
